  • My Snoek has been made significantly more stable on descents. Sidewinds and traffic passing in the other direction are the main problems, most seriously when there are unpredictable sidewind gusts. A long time ago, I posted a video of the Snoek tail wagging in the sidewind. I'm confident those days are over.

    I have to repare my Snoek, So I was thinking of adding some surface at the rear. What do you think of a wider rear rim for the 32-622 tires? Perhaps also front tires with less grip...

    • @shenzhenpingpong
      @shenzhenpingpong  Před 20 dny +1

      Wider rim is good as the tire becomes even wider. But it's hard to get a very wide tire into the rear opening. I think 32mm is ok. But wider than that with a wide rim may be difficult to install and may rub easily against the wall of the rear wheel housing.
